Eagles’ JaCorey Shepherd Tears ACL

The Eagles announced that cornerback JaCorey Shepherd has suffered a torn ACL, as Adam Caplan of ESPN.com tweets. The diagnosis is fairly devastating for the Eagles, who just traded away slot cornerback Brandon Boykin. Shepherd was considered the frontrunner to take over for Boykin’s former patrol.

With Shepherd done for the year, Jaylen Watkins, E.J. Biggers, and Denzel Rice are left as the remaining options at slot cornerback. The Eagles also could turn to cornerbacks Byron Maxwell and Nolan Carroll or safeties Malcolm Jenkins and Walter Thurmond as options at nickel, Jeff McLane of the Philadelphia Inquirer tweets. Still, those moves would be far from ideal for Philly. It wouldn’t be surprising to see Chip Kelly and the Eagles explore outside options between now and the start of the season.
